Romans promised to Janus

Throughout the years, Romans made promises to Janus for the new year. They made sacrifices to Janus along with gifts exchanged on New Year's Day. They also made a resolution that usually was a promise of good behaviour for the coming year.

According to Roman mythology, Janus had two faces, one that looked forward in the direction of the future, while the other one looked toward the past. Janus was the protector of bridges, doors and thresholds. His two faces enabled him to look in the future and look backwards simultaneously.

According to ancient legends that the most important thing you could do during New Year's Day was to adopt a resolution. Essentially, this was an offer of goodwill to God for the coming year.

Chinese

Xin Nian, also known as the Chinese New Year, is the most important celebration in China. It's celebrated over several days, generally from January 21 through February 20 on the Chinese calendar.

Before the Chinese New Year everyone prepares their homes and spend time with relatives. They also enjoy special meals and conduct rituals. These rituals are believed clear the home of negative luck and remove evil spirits.

The lighting of fireworks is common in many areas to scare away the evil. Dancer dances also are danced to bring luck.

A Chinese New Year also signifies the start of spring. People send good luck wishes and pray for a favorable harvest.

German

In the past, the German New Year is traditionally celebrated on the 31st of December. This is referred as the Silvester. The name comes from the fourth century Pope Sylvester I. His feast day is also celebrated on this date.

In the month of Silvester, Germans make preparations for the new year. They drink, eat, and present gifts that bring luck. They also wear numerous good luck charms.
